Gary Bowyer slams defensive display in draw with Brighton & Hove Albion

Gary Bowyer slams an "unacceptable" defensive performance from his side after Blackburn Rovers draw 3-3 with Brighton & Hove Albion.

Blackburn Rovers manager Gary Bowyer has admitted that his side's defensive performance was "unacceptable" in the 3-3 draw with Brighton & Hove Albion.

Rovers twice took the lead after falling behind early on against Brighton, but they were forced to settle for a point when Dale Stephens scored with a header just moments after Jordan Rhodes had netted from the spot for the hosts at Ewood Park.

"We just said there we can't keep saying 'we've scored three goals'. We've scored eight in the last three games and we've got three points to show for it," Bowyer told reporters.

"The manner in which we conceded the goals is not acceptable. We've kept 12 clean sheets this season and we have to get back to that quickly because we're scoring goals.

"We've got to turn these performances into results and start winning games instead of drawing games otherwise it's going to cost us."

Blackburn are currently 11th in the Championship, seven points outside the playoff spots.
